Zhuzhou CRRC Times Electric Co., Ltd., together with its subsidiaries, engages in the research, development, design, manufacture, and sale of railway transportation equipment products, and provision of relevant services primarily in Mainland China and internationally. The company's products include traction converter systems of rail transit vehicles, railway engineering machinery, and communication signal systems. It also produces propulsion and control systems for trains and electric vehicles, signaling systems, power supply solutions, platform screen doors, rail maintenance vehicles, marine engineering equipment, and component products for various applications. The company's products for rolling stock and railways include EMU, locomotive, and mass transit systems; and components products consist of semiconductors, resistors, reactors, radiators, sensors, power capacitors, and heatsinks. Its energy and industrial products comprise marine engineering, electric vehicle, and inverter and converter systems, as well as provides railway maintenance and construction machines. The company was formerly known as Zhuzhou CSR Times Electric Co., Ltd. and changed its name to Zhuzhou CRRC Times Electric Co., Ltd. in March 2016. The company was incorporated in 2005 and is based in Wanchai, Hong Kong. Zhuzhou CRRC Times Electric Co., Ltd. is a subsidiary of CRRC Zhuzhou Institute Co., Ltd.

The company's core focus is now split between its Innovative Medicine (formerly Pharmaceutical) segment, which offers prescription products for complex diseases such as rheumatoid arthritis, various cancers, HIV/AIDS, and neurodegenerative disorders; and its MedTech (Medical Devices) segment, which provides advanced technology solutions including electrophysiology products, neurovascular care products, orthopaedics (hips, knees, spine), advanced surgery solutions, and disposable contact lenses under the ACUVUE brand. Company's two remaining segments primarily serve hospitals, healthcare professionals, wholesalers, and retailers, continuing its mission of advancing human health since its founding in 1886 and its current basing in New Brunswick, New Jersey.
